I started with a touch off tool into input 7 with parameter set to ToolTouchOffTriggered and it worked perfectly.
I want to add a probe and I am now testing with just the probe connected. It seems to be working well I have ProbeTripped as the parameter for input 7. I also have Input 6 set to ProbeDectect. I have a switch that can turn the led on the board on/off. I eventually want to use an on-off-on spdt switch to change between probes. I am following page 15 of the Acorn Probe setup guide and want to know if using just one switch is appropriate
I am looking for some general advice on the best way to have both probes available - only one at a time is necessary. I was also considering a front panel mount connector that each probe would get plugged into as needed.
The probe is a Drewtronics S5000LED. The touch off tool is a Metrol limit switch P11EDB-DULD https://www.automationdirect.com/adc/sh ... 11edb-duld. Both are NC and I would like to know if they provide the probe detect signal
